84 /** struct annotated_source - symbols with hits have this attached as in sannotation
85  *
86  * @histogram: Array of addr hit histograms per event being monitored
87  * @lines: If 'print_lines' is specified, per source code line percentages
88  * @source: source parsed from a disassembler like objdump -dS
89  *
90  * lines is allocated, percentages calculated and all sorted by percentage
91  * when the annotation is about to be presented, so the percentages are for
92  * one of the entries in the histogram array, i.e. for the event/counter being
93  * presented. It is deallocated right after symbol__{tui,tty,etc}_annotate
94  * returns.
95  */
96 struct annotated_source {
97 	struct list_head   source;
98 	struct source_line *lines;
99 	int    		   nr_histograms;
100 	int    		   sizeof_sym_hist;
101 	struct sym_hist	   histograms[0];
102 };
103 
104 struct annotation {
105 	pthread_mutex_t		lock;
106 	struct annotated_source *src;
107 };
